上文我們為大家介紹虛擬貨幣的硬分叉,以及它的好處壞處,接下來我們便要介紹,軟分叉(Softfork)是什麼。簡單來說,軟分叉就是原來的虛擬貨幣因有了共識而發布新規則後,沒有升級的節點會因為不知道新共識規則下,而生產不合法的區塊,就會產生臨時性分叉,這種臨時性的分裂便是軟分叉的由來。
虛擬貨幣會不斷的改良內部機制,當中便會產生分叉(Fork)。由於虛擬貨幣的原始程式碼是公開發佈的,任何虛擬貨幣的擁有者都能修改。如果有修改者修改完的新版本能夠跟舊版本相容,那就稱為軟分岔(Softfork);反之便出現不能兼容的情況,分叉後的交易便會跟原區塊鏈(Blockchain)完全脫鉤,成為一種新的虛擬貨幣,這個分裂的過程,就是我們上文提及的硬分叉(Hardfork)。
圖片來源:比特幣中文資訊攻略
以Bitcoin為例,軟分叉可以保證任何人在不用升級的情況下,兼容升級(例如改變Block Size)後,在新機制下繼續運行的Bitcoin;另外,他們在區塊鏈的層面沒有分叉鏈,只有新區塊和舊區塊的分別,而且軟分叉容許挖礦者在相當長的時間裡,保持原有版本,繼續使用原版本生成舊區塊,與新區塊並存。
圖片來源:比特幣中文資訊攻略
虛擬貨幣經歷過多次重大的分叉,例如Bitcoin(BTC)分裂出Bitcoin Cash(BCH)、以太幣分裂成以太幣(Ethereum,ETH)和經典以太幣(Ethereum Classic,ETC)。至於上月Bitcoin Cash的再分裂,成為原來Bitcoin Cash的代表Bitcoin ABC,以及新的虛擬貨幣Bitcoin SV,又是一次非常經典的硬分叉事件。究竟從Bitcoin Cash硬分叉而成的Bitcoin ABC及Bitcoin SV有什麼分別?為什麼會引發這一次的分叉?拾捌堂詳細告訴大家!
三大編輯精選: